  "agent_context": "**The gist** Google shipped two models to the Gemini API and AI Studio on June 30, 2026: **Nano Banana 2 Lite** (gemini-3.1-flash-lite-image), producing 1K-resolution images in about **4 seconds** for **$0.034** each, and **Gemini Omni Flash** (gemini-omni-flash-preview), a video generation and editing model priced at $0.10 per second of output.\n\n**Why it matters** These are priced for programmatic use: image generation cheap enough to call in a loop from a coding agent, and video with **conversational editing** and multimodal inputs at **10-second** clips. Both are callable now through the **Gemini API**, so asset-generation steps can move inside your build pipelines instead of a separate design tool.\n\n**Watch out** Omni Flash is **preview**-grade: the API accepts video references over **3 seconds** but doesn't process them correctly, audio references and scene extension aren't exposed via the API yet, and character consistency degrades across scene changes and panning shots.",
